3.2. Монтирование файловой системы

Before you can mount a GFS2 file system, the file system must exist (refer to Раздел 3.1, «Создание файловой системы»), the volume where the file system exists must be activated, and the supporting clustering and locking systems must be started (refer to Configuring and Managing a Red Hat Cluster). After those requirements have been met, you can mount the GFS2 file system as you would any Linux file system.
Чтобы манипулировать списками ACL, смонтируйте файловую систему с опцией -o acl. В противном случае пользователи будут иметь возможность просмотра списков ACL (с помощью getfacl), но не смогут их изменять (с помощью setfacl).

3.2.1. Формат

Mounting Without ACL Manipulation
mount BlockDevice MountPoint
Mounting With ACL Manipulation
mount -o acl BlockDevice MountPoint
-o acl
Параметр GFS2 для манипулирования списками ACL.
BlockDevice
Задает блочное устройство, на котором расположена файловая система GFS2.
MountPoint
Определяет каталог, в который монтируется GFS2.

3.2.2. Пример

В этом примере GFS2 на устройстве /dev/vg01/lvol0 будет смонтирована в каталог /mygfs2.
mount /dev/vg01/lvol0 /mygfs2

3.2.3. Полная форма

mount BlockDevice MountPoint -o option
The -o option argument consists of GFS2-specific options (refer to Таблица 3.2, «Опции монтирования GFS2») or acceptable standard Linux mount -o options, or a combination of both. Multiple option parameters are separated by a comma and no spaces.

Примечание

mount является системной командой Linux, стандартные опции которой также можно использовать (например, -r) вместе с опциями GFS2. Информация об опциях mount может быть найдена на странице помощи mount.
Таблица 3.2, «Опции монтирования GFS2» describes the available GFS2-specific -o option values that can be passed to GFS2 at mount time.

Таблица 3.2. Опции монтирования GFS2

Опция Описание
acl Позволяет манипулировать списками ACL. Если файловая система смонтирована без опции acl, то пользователи будут иметь возможность просмотра списков ACL (с помощью getfacl), но не смогут их изменять (с помощью setfacl).
data=[ordered|writeback] Если задан параметр data=ordered, то данные пользователя будут сохранены на диск, прежде чем результаты транзакции будут записаны на диск, что позволит избежать отображения неинициализированных блоков в файле в случае аварийного завершения работы. При указании data=writeback данные пользователя будут записываться на диск в любое время, что позволит ускорить скорость работы в некоторых случаях, но не гарантирует постоянства, которое гарантирует режим ordered. По умолчанию используется режим ordered.
ignore_local_fs
Осторожно! Эта опция НЕ должна использоваться, если к файловым системам GFS2 открыт совместный доступ.
Заставляет GFS2 рассматривать файловую систему как систему с несколькими узлами. lock_nolock по умолчанию автоматически включает флаги localcaching и localflocks.
localcaching
Осторожно! Эта опция НЕ должна использоваться, если к файловым системам GFS2 открыт совместный доступ.
Сообщает системе GFS2 о том, что она выполняет роль локальной файловой системы. Так, GFS2 сможет использовать некоторые возможности, которые недоступны в кластерном режиме. lock_nolock автоматически установит флаг localcaching.
localflocks
Осторожно! Эта опция НЕ должна использоваться, если к файловым системам GFS2 открыт совместный доступ.
Разрешает слою VFS (Virtual File System) выполнение flock и fcntl. lock_nolock автоматически установит флаг localflocks.
lockproto=МодульБлокирования Позволяет пользователю задать протокол блокирования. Если параметр МодульБлокирования не указан, имя протокола будет получено из суперблока файловой системы.
locktable=ТаблицаБлокирования Позволяет пользователю задать таблицу блокирования.
quota=[off/account/on] Позволяет управлять квотами. Значение account обеспечит корректную поддержку статистики использования для каждого UID/GID. При этом значения limit и warn будут игнорироваться. По умолчанию этот параметр установлен в off.
upgrade Обновляет формат файловой системы, так чтобы она могла использоваться новыми версиями GFS2.